The GCF of 28 and 6 is the largest … WebGreatest common factor examples. The greatest common factor (GCF) of a set of numbers is the largest factor that all the numbers share. For example, 12, 20, and 24 have two common factors: 2 and 4. The largest is 4, so we say that the GCF of 12, 20, and 24 is 4. GCF is often used to find common denominators.

WebWhat is the GCF of 6 and 28? The first step to find the gcf of 6 and 28 is to list the factors of each number. The factors of 6 are 1, 2, 3 and 6. The factors of 28 are 1, 2, 4, 7, 14 and 28. So, the Greatest Common Factor for these numbers is 2 because it divides all them without a remainder. Read more about Common Factors below.
